“So Close I’m on a mission to find the best breakfast in mid-Pinellas County. Remy’s is right up there, but just shy of being the best. The café is clean, nicely decorated and welcoming. Staff is pleasant. Air conditioning and fans, unfortunately, blow down, cooling the food too fast. I got the standard thing: 2 eggs scrambled (fine), ham (delicious and one of the best) and grits. Why are grits the downfall of so many local cafes?! Texture was OK, but they were bland! I upgraded the included regular toast to French toast. This is one of the best French toasts I’ve had in these parts. While the bread slices were thick, they were properly cooked and not soggy in the middle (woohoo!) There was even a slice of orange on the plate (albeit dried out). Coffee was, by café standards, strong and good. The correct score should be 4.5 stars, but I’ll gladly round up because of the ham and French toast. Sooo close—just fix the grits.“

“Always Busy & Always Good Pretty simple: the place is pleasant, the staff is nice and the food is very good. We got a Ham Benedict and the Speggtacular Special. The potatoes were very good—nice and crispy. The Hollandaise sauce was quite nice. There were a couple of items that came up short. The grits were bland (why is it so hard to find good grits?) and the ham was so-so. But that was made up for by the the quality of the rest of the meal. A big plus here is the fresh fruit. There is always a few pieces of nice, fresh fruit on every plate.“
